Uwe Schmidt is one of the most prolific contemporary electronic musicians of our era, with over 200 releases produced under a dizzying array of aliases. Perhaps his most well known and celebrated project is Señor Coconut, of “Cha cha cha” Kraftwerk cover fame. We’ve heard many dozens of Uwe’s releases and consider more than a few of them to be Bunker classics that are in constant rotation at both our house and on our dancefloor.

When we first heard his compilation of tunes organized as a satirical history of acid house released under the Atom™ moniker – “Acid Evolution 1988-2003”, we started hounding Uwe about performing this material live at The Bunker. We eventually got him to perform an improvised live hardware set with Tobias, then were lucky enough to have him perform his A/V set for us, and most recently were treated to a solo techno set of the Ground Loop material just last year.

We asked Uwe to flesh out a few of the clips he’d put online of Ground Loop material with a view to releasing a record for The Bunker and two days later these two monsters landed in our inbox. Two brand new Atom™ dancefloor acid explosions that stand alongside the best of his work. Enjoy!

If there was a Top Of The Pops for DIY electronics, then St Leidal the 2nd‘s slice of sun-kissed exotica heaven would probably be number one for months to come. Up and coming Hungarian producer, András Leidal had explored practically everything between shoegaze and acid before starting his solo project, St Leidal the 2nd in 2009 – he is part of Wedding Acid Group’s trio, whose anthology was released on Farbwechsel this past spring.

Following a couple of self-released EPs and a refined release on 8ounce records, Future Tiberian Baths is András’s most accomplished work to date. Similarly to St Leidal’s previous works, it is a collection of sample laden, beat driven songs that sound like listening to an octopus jamming to a sleazy 80s teenage movie theme from the inside of an aquarium. These eight originals are all built from an almost transparent fabric that melts both your mind and your body, recalling the best moments of vaporwave. What makes St Leidal the 2nd stand out though is his effortless, almost minimalistic approach that lets him fuse hopeful melancholy and nostalgia with an array of influences with suave ease and confidence.

Amen Tma is a project of ::.: and acidmilk. Spiritually a successor to Angakkut, but musically a completely different entity, it was conceived in late 2011 for the purpose of experimentation with combining composition techniques of electroacoustic music, balinese gamelan and polymetric techno.

Spanning nearly three years of work, their debut album Insect Phonetics Research yields a study in sibilant stridulation sounds, interwoven with messages preaching an ever approaching Eschaton. This material is complete with a bonus live recording alongside remixes by Sion Orgon, Loyu, Drakh, Makkatu, Rentip, &apos, RBNX and Urbanfailure, resulting in a total 90 minutes of music.

Gracefully Force Consensus is an hour long split tape between PMM and Tuff Sherm. Two halves of the same whole or two independent artists? Or perhaps one works while the other sleeps?

On this cassette the artists trade tracks instead of the usual side each, PMM’s track titles appear to be lifted from a book on becoming a star while Tuff Sherm’s titles are all named after existing albums. Just how much is in the Tuff Sherm vault?

This tape is staggering in it’s breadth of sound, mood and approach: moments sound like disco 45’s having been given a sandpaper rubdown, other drumless works provide instant enlightenment. Tuff Sherm produces some of his most raw and rugged material so far taking the futuristic primitive approach to new levels of intensity by setting up huge mechanical automatons, lubricated with rain and sweat, that follow their own relentless path until a rainbow appears in the room. PMM resides in the chasm between music and non-music: gnarled tone poetry, metallic clangs and overblown keys.

First Edition Gatefold 2LP includes a copy of the CD inside – Vinyl & CD separately mastered for “maximum sonic perfection”. Produced by Russell Haswell** Russell Haswell joins Philip Best’s Consumer Electronics for the face-melting force of ‘Estuary Electronics’. Following on from the Mattin-produced ‘Crowd Pleaser’ (2009), it finds the pioneering duo at their most virile and vital across seven tracks rife with sputtering tech-n0!se and, of course, Best’s spray it, don’t say it delivery. It’s a cruel, vicious f**ker and therein lies its charm in showing up most of their field as dilettantes. Between the flatulent jag of ‘Teknon’ to the staggering, ‘floor bleaching force of ‘Co-opted’ or the ‘Air Lock’ monologue that seals the final side, it delivers visceral thrills in a way most others can’t compete with. And it’s all the more powerful for its reduced and optimised palette – vocals, spatter drums and eviscerated electronics stoically delivered with real venom where it matters. For adventurous DJs, proper wrong ‘uns, and the noise brigade, it’s stone cold essential.
